A prominent Israeli newspaper Maariv has placed a photo of president of Syria Bashar Assad and president of Iran Mahmoud Ahmadinejad during the official visit of the later in Syria, while placing on the second page a photo of the president of France Jacques Chirac, during his visit to France's nuclear submarine base, in reference to his warning to nuke the terrorists and their supporters.

Being enough to place those two photographs in such proximity, the real fun starts when you look at Chirac's photo thro the light:
